## Configuration

Hey plugin folks! TallyGate loads plugins after reading its `.env` file, so your hooks get the same config the core turnstile counter sees. Defaults cover polling and the Marrowfield Stadium zone map. You just need the signing credential for the plugin bus — add this line to `.env`:

sealed setting: VAULT_KEY20=c8ea1e419912889df6b4

### 2024-11-08 — Key rotation (cron drift follow-up)

Rotated the Ticktock scheduler's deploy key after the cron drift investigation on the Bramblehurst fleet. Root cause: stale crontab pushed by an agent still signing with the retired key. Old key revoked; all drifted nodes re-synced and verified. Release manager action: confirm the next Ticktock release is signed with the replacement before promotion. The new key is as follows.

signing key of bagap-yawep = bky13_TbfT6ZMUoGJo2

# Basement Archive Room — Night Access

The archive room under Pellworth House holds old contracts and the tape backups. Night shift: take stairwell C, not the lift (it's switched off after midnight). Lights are on a timer by the door — slap the button as you go in. Sign the logbook, even at 3am, yes really. The keypad by the door takes the code below.

staff pass of fahap-tajeg = bdg-FT-6

Briefing: Training Budget FY Next

For heads of department. The proposed training budget rises modestly, with allocations weighted toward the Kelmar certification track and supervisory coaching at the Dunwich site. Per-head caps remain unchanged. Final figures depend on a strategic decision not yet announced beyond this group. The relevant confidential note is appended directly below this briefing.

board note of kageg-bahof: The renewal with Holwynax Holdings closes at $2 million a year, 5 percent below the last contract. Project Ulaath slips by two quarters because of the supplier delay.

# Who to Contact: SQL Linting Rules

All SQL files in the Fernwick monorepo are checked by our linter, Squintly, on every merge request. Support staff should not grant lint exemptions themselves; rule changes require review because downstream migration tooling depends on consistent formatting. If a user reports a false positive, collect the file path, the rule code, and the Squintly version before escalating. For rule clarifications, exemption requests, or suspected linter bugs, write to the Data Tooling guild at the address shown below.

pager mailbox: druwyn@norvaio.corp